Job Purpose and Summary
At CVS Health, we help people navigate health care by improving access and quality. Within our retail locations, Pharmacy Technicians play a critical role in supporting pharmacy teams to consistently deliver on our brand promise. As a Technician, you will support the pharmacy team in delivering operational and service excellence. You are often the first point of contact for patients and customers, ensuring prescriptions are filled promptly and accurately while providing caring service that exceeds expectations.
You will apply standard operating procedures, best practices, and effective communication to contribute to a safe and inclusive culture.
- Live our purpose by following all company SOPs at each workstation to help our Pharmacists manage and improve patient health.
- Follow pharmacy workflow procedures at each pharmacy workstation (production, pick‑up, drive‑thru, drop‑off) for safe and accurate prescription fulfillment.
- Contribute to positive patient experiences by showing empathy and genuine care: create heartfelt and personalized moments while serving patients at pick‑up, drive‑thru, and over the phone; offer immunizations and other services; and solve or escalation patient problems.
- Complete basic inventory activities, as permitted by law, and as directed by pharmacy leadership: accurately putting away medication deliveries, completing cycle counts, returns‑to‑stocks, waiting bin inventories, etc.
- Contribute to a high‑performing team, embrace a growth mindset, and be receptive to feedback; actively seek opportunities to expand clinical and technical knowledge needed to better assist patients.
- Remain flexible for both scheduling and business needs and, if needed, travel to stores in the market to work shifts.
- Understand and comply with all relevant federal, state, and local laws, regulations, professional standards, and ethical principles. Comply with CVS policies and procedures to ensure patient safety, controlled substance dispensing and record‑keeping, and patient privacy and security.
- Deliver additional patient health care services (immunizations, point‑of‑care testing, and voluntarily staffing off‑site clinics) where allowable by law and supported by required training and certification.
- Regular and predictable attendance, including nights and weekends.
- Ability to complete required training within designated timeframe.
- Attention and focus: concentrate on tasks, pivot quickly, confirm prescription information and label accuracy.
- Customer service and team orientation: actively look for ways to help people, notice and respond appropriately to patients’ reactions.
- Communication skills: use and understand verbal and written communication; utilize active listening; ask questions; avoid interruptions.
- Mathematical reasoning: use math to solve dispensing problems (total tablets, day’s supply, bottle quantity).
- Problem resolution: identify challenging interactions and choose best action.
- Physical demands: including mobility, lifting, reaching, repetitive finger use, visual acuity, and occasional lifting of up to 20 lbs.
